Is the pounds per square meter to gallons per hectare conversion exact?
The numeric factor shown (1198264.273) is calculated from each unit's defined scale, but Pounds per square meter and Gallons per hectare belong to different agriculture measurement families (mass application rate vs liquid application rate). A direct physical conversion between the two requires them to share the same measurement family; use this figure as a scale reference rather than a like-for-like agronomic equivalence.

About this conversion
Pounds per square meter and Gallons per hectare are units used in the Universal Converter agriculture category. Pound per Square Meter (lb/m2): Mass application rate. Gallon per Hectare (gal/ha): Liquid application rate.
Pounds per square meter belongs to the mass application rate family, while Gallons per hectare belongs to the liquid application rate family. The agriculture converter is dimension-aware, so a direct conversion between units from different families is not agronomically meaningful without extra context (such as a crop's bulk density or field application details); the scale factor above is provided purely for numeric reference.
